将两个有序链表合并为一个新的有序链表并返回。新链表是通过拼接给定的两个链表的所有节点组成的。
示例:
输入:1->2->4, 1->3->4
输出:1->1->2->3->4->4

方法一:
迭代
/**
* Definition for singly-linked list.
* struct ListNode {
* int val;
* ListNode *next;
* ListNode(int x) : val(x), next(NULL) {}
* };
*/
class Solution {
public:
ListNode* mergeTwoLists(ListNode* l1, ListNode* l2) {
ListNode newHead(-1);
ListNode* ptr = &newHead;
while (l1 && l2) {
if (l1->val < l2->val){
ptr->next = l1;
l1 = l1->next;
} else {
ptr->next = l2;
l2 = l2->next;
}
ptr = ptr->next;
}
if (l1)
ptr->next = l1;
if (l2)
ptr->next = l2;
return newHead.next;
}
};
方法二:
递归
/**
* Definition for singly-linked list.
* struct ListNode {
* int val;
* ListNode *next;
* ListNode(int x) : val(x), next(NULL) {}
* };
*/
class Solution {
public:
ListNode* mergeTwoLists(ListNode* l1, ListNode* l2) {
if (!l1)
return l2;
if (!l2)
return l1;
if (l1->val < l2->val){
l1->next = mergeTwoLists(l1->next, l2);
return l1;
}
else {
l2->next = mergeTwoLists(l1, l2->next);
return l2;
}
}
};
